Demonstration Site Case Studies

In 2001, NACCHO selected nine communities to serve as demonstration sites for the newly developed MAPP tool. NACCHO was able to follow six of the nine original communities through the six phases of MAPP. The following documents describe each community's experience and the process they went through using the MAPP tool. The case studies also provide links to resources used and lessons learned. Columbus (OH)
 
The Columbus Health Department, in conjunction with a core group representing the business, faith, and public health communities, led the MAPP process in four neighborhoods.
 
»
Lee County (FL)
 
Among other MAPP experiences, Lee County provides guidance on using the recommended National Public Health Performance Standards local instrument for the local public health system assessment.
 
»
Mendocino County (CA)
 
Mendocino County implemented MAPP in three different communities. Their MAPP process worked to address each community goal within the context of the county-level MAPP process.
 
»
Nashville (TN)
 
Nashville is an excellent example of leveraging leadership support and marketing MAPP within the health department.
 
»
Northern Kentucky
 
The northern Kentucky experience offers insight on how to integrate MAPP with other planning efforts.
 
»
San Antonio (TX)
 
San Antonio implemented MAPP citywide, integrated the PACE-EH process in the Goals and Strategies phase, and utilized TOP facilitation techniques.
